Freigeben über


PartitionProperties Klasse

  • java.lang.Object
    • com.azure.messaging.eventhubs.PartitionProperties

public final class PartitionProperties

Ein Satz von Informationen für eine einzelne Partition eines Event Hubs.

Methodenzusammenfassung

Modifizierer und Typ Methode und Beschreibung
long getBeginningSequenceNumber()

Ruft die Startsequenznummer des Nachrichtendatenstroms der Partition ab.

String getEventHubName()

Ruft den Namen des Event Hubs ab, der die Partition enthält.

String getId()

Ruft den Bezeichner der Partition im Event Hub ab.

String getLastEnqueuedOffset()

Ruft den Offset der letzten in die Warteschlange eingereihten Nachricht im Datenstrom der Partition ab.

long getLastEnqueuedSequenceNumber()

Ruft die letzte Sequenznummer des Nachrichtendatenstroms der Partition ab.

Instant getLastEnqueuedTime()

Ruft die sofortige (in UTC) der letzten in die Warteschlange eingereihten Nachricht im Datenstrom der Partition ab.

boolean isEmpty()

Gibt an, ob die Partition derzeit leer ist.

Geerbte Methoden von java.lang.Object

Details zur Methode

getBeginningSequenceNumber

public long getBeginningSequenceNumber()

Ruft die Startsequenznummer des Nachrichtendatenstroms der Partition ab.

Returns:

Die Startsequenznummer des Nachrichtendatenstroms der Partition.

getEventHubName

public String getEventHubName()

Ruft den Namen des Event Hubs ab, der die Partition enthält.

Returns:

Der Name des Event Hubs, der die Partition enthält.

getId

public String getId()

Ruft den Bezeichner der Partition im Event Hub ab.

Returns:

Der Bezeichner der Partition im Event Hub.

getLastEnqueuedOffset

public String getLastEnqueuedOffset()

Ruft den Offset der letzten in die Warteschlange eingereihten Nachricht im Datenstrom der Partition ab.

Der Offset ist die relative Position für das Ereignis im Kontext des Datenstroms. Der Offset sollte nicht als stabiler Wert betrachtet werden, da sich der gleiche Offset möglicherweise auf ein anderes Ereignis beziehen kann, da Ereignisse die Altersgrenze für die Aufbewahrung erreichen und nicht mehr innerhalb des Datenstroms sichtbar sind.

Returns:

Der Offset der zuletzt in die Warteschlange eingereihten Nachricht im Datenstrom der Partition.

getLastEnqueuedSequenceNumber

public long getLastEnqueuedSequenceNumber()

Ruft die letzte Sequenznummer des Nachrichtendatenstroms der Partition ab.

Returns:

Die letzte Sequenznummer des Nachrichtendatenstroms der Partition.

getLastEnqueuedTime

public Instant getLastEnqueuedTime()

Ruft die sofortige (in UTC) der letzten in die Warteschlange eingereihten Nachricht im Datenstrom der Partition ab.

Returns:

Der Zeitpunkt (in UTC) der letzten in die Warteschlange eingereihten Nachricht im Datenstrom der Partition.

isEmpty

public boolean isEmpty()

Gibt an, ob die Partition derzeit leer ist.

Returns:

true , wenn keine Ereignisse vorhanden sind, andernfalls false .

Gilt für: